Sunan an-Nasai 2147 (Book 22, Hadith 58) #16758
The Blessing of Sahur

SUMMARY: Eating Sahur (pre-dawn meal) is a blessing from Allah.

It was narrated that Abu Hurairah said: "The Messenger of Allah said; 'Take Sahur, for in Sahur there is blessing"".
أَخْبَرَنَا عَلِيُّ بْنُ سَعِيدِ بْنِ جَرِيرٍ، - نَسَائِيٌّ - قَالَ حَدَّثَنَا أَبُو الرَّبِيعِ، قَالَ حَدَّثَنَا مَنْصُورُ بْنُ أَبِي الأَسْوَدِ، عَنْ عَبْدِ الْمَلِكِ بْنِ أَبِي سُلَيْمَانَ، عَنْ عَطَاءٍ، عَنْ أَبِي هُرَيْرَةَ، قَالَ قَالَ رَسُولُ اللَّهِ ‏ "‏ تَسَحَّرُوا فَإِنَّ فِي السَّحُورِ بَرَكَةً

EXPLANATIONS:
This hadith, narrated by Abu Hurairah, speaks about the importance of taking sahur, which is the pre-dawn meal during Ramadan. The Prophet Muhammad ﷺ said that there is a blessing in taking sahur and encouraged people to take it. This hadith teaches us that we should be grateful for the blessings that Allah has given us and use them to our advantage. Taking sahur helps us to have energy throughout the day during Ramadan and also helps us to stay focused on our worship and ibadah throughout the day. It also teaches us that we should not waste any blessings or opportunities given by Allah as they are all valuable gifts from Him.
